55 A BILL TO BE ENTITLED
66 AN ACT
77 relating to the application of whistleblower protection laws to
88 certain appointed municipal officers.
99 B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F TEXAS:
1010 SECTION 1. Section 554.001(4), Government Code, is amended
1111 to read as follows:
1212 (4) "Public employee" means:
1313 (A) an employee or appointed officer other than
1414 an independent contractor who is paid to perform services for a
1515 state or local governmental entity; or
1616 (B) an appointed officer who is an independent
1717 contractor paid to perform services for a general-law municipality.
1818 SECTION 2. The change in law made by this Act applies only
1919 to a report by a public employee of a violation of law that is made
2020 on or after the effective date of this Act. A report by a public
2121 employee of a violation of law made before the effective date of
2222 this Act is governed by the law in effect when that report is made,
2323 and the former law is continued in effect for that purpose.
2424 SECTION 3. This Act takes effect immediately if it receives
2525 a vote of two-thirds of all the members elected to each house, as
2626 provided by Section 39, Article III, Texas Constitution. If this
2727 Act does not receive the vote necessary for immediate effect, this
2828 Act takes effect September 1, 2019.
